What Buyers Are Looking for on Lake Martin in 2026
The Lake Martin real estate market continues to evolve, and so do buyer expectations. In 2026, buyers are not just looking for a home on the water. They are looking for a lifestyle that feels easy, functional, and ready to enjoy from day one.

Here are the features buyers are paying the most attention to right now.
Usable Waterfront and Consistent Water Depth
One of the biggest priorities for buyers is functional waterfront access.
Beautiful views matter, but buyers also want water they can actually use comfortably throughout the year.
High demand features include:
Deep water access during multiple seasons
Easy navigation from dock to open water
Stable shoreline conditions
Clear, swimmable water areas
Comfortable entry points for swimming and boating
On Lake Martin, usability matters just as much as appearance.
Updated and Functional Docks
For many buyers, the dock is just as important as the house itself.
A well designed dock setup immediately improves the lake experience and often becomes one of the first things buyers evaluate.
Buyers are often looking for:
Covered boat slips
Newer or well maintained dock structures
Seating and entertaining space
Easy water access
Convenient setup for storing lake equipment
A strong dock setup can make a property stand out quickly in a competitive market.
Outdoor Living Spaces Buyers Will Actually Use
Outdoor space has become one of the biggest lifestyle priorities for lake buyers. Buyers want homes that allow them to spend as much time outside as possible.
Popular features include:
Covered porches with lake views
Outdoor kitchens and grilling areas
Fire pits and gathering spaces
Large decks for entertaining
Seamless indoor and outdoor flow
The best lake homes feel connected to the water even when you are inside.
Open Floor Plans and Natural Views
Inside the home, buyers continue to prioritize layouts that feel open, comfortable, and designed around the view.
Key preferences include:
Open concept kitchen and living spaces
Large windows overlooking the water
Main level living when possible
Natural lighting throughout the home
Functional entertaining spaces
Buyers want homes that feel relaxed, easy to host in, and centered around lake living.
Move In Ready Homes Continue to Perform Well
Turnkey homes remain highly desirable on Lake Martin.
Many buyers want to spend their first summer enjoying the lake, not managing a renovation project.
Features buyers consistently prefer include:
Updated kitchens and bathrooms
Modern flooring and finishes
Neutral, clean design
Minimal immediate maintenance needs
Homes that feel updated and easy to maintain often generate stronger buyer interest.
Storage Still Matters for Lake Living
Lake living comes with equipment, water toys, and additional gear. Functional storage continues to be a major selling point.
Important features include:
Garage space for boats and lake equipment
Extra parking for guests
Organized storage rooms
Easy loading and unloading access
Space for golf carts and outdoor gear
Practical features often make everyday lake life much easier.
Buyers on Lake Martin in 2026 are focused on lifestyle, functionality, and long term enjoyment. Homes that meet these desires tend to attract stronger interest and great results.
